Superior Contracting & Maintenance Superior Contracting & Maintenance is actively seeking experienced remediation professionals to join our contractor network for residential and property-related repair projects. We offer ongoing project opportunities for dependable contractors looking for flexible scheduling, consistent assignments, and fast payment processing. This role is ideal for independent contractors with remediation or restoration experience who can manage projects professionally while maintaining strong communication and delivering quality workmanship from start to finish. About Us Superior Contracting & Maintenance is a trusted repair and maintenance company with over 13 years of industry experience. We partner with homeowners, property management groups, and project teams to provide dependable repair and maintenance services across a wide range of trades. Our services include roofing, gutters, siding, painting, plumbing, electrical, carpentry, flooring, remediation, kitchen and bath repairs, and general property maintenance. Key Responsibilities Inspect property damage and determine appropriate remediation solutions Develop remediation or repair plans based on project requirements Coordinate with project managers, residents, homeowners, and clients as needed Schedule and oversee crews or subcontractors when applicable Maintain project timelines while ensuring quality and professionalism Follow safety requirements and remediation best practices throughout each project Submit updates, progress photos, and final documentation through the online portal
Requirements Preferred:
3+ years of remediation, restoration, or related property repair experience Active General Liability Insurance required (COI must be provided) Strong understanding of remediation processes and safety procedures Ability to work independently and manage active projects efficiently Strong communication and organizational skills Must own necessary tools and dependable transportation Comfortable using online portal systems for updates and communication Must currently reside and operate within the United States What We Offer Flexible scheduling with self-managed workload Ongoing remediation and restoration opportunities Fast payment processing after work verification Direct assignments with no lead fees or subscription costs Local projects within your service coverage area If you are dependable, experienced, and interested in ongoing remediation opportunities, we encourage you to apply.
